The big telecom show Mobile World Congress kicks off in Barcelona this week. Expect a lot of talk about phones and the things you can do with them. After reports last week that Apple and Goldman Sachs might launch a credit card potentially tied to the iPhone's digital wallet, there will probably be plenty of talk about mobile payments. But weren't we supposed to be paying for everything with our phones by now? Host Molly Wood talks with Lisa Ellis, who covers payment services at the research firm MoffettNathanson. She says when we moved to chip-based credit cards a few years back, we kind of missed the mobile boat.
